At Nationals Park on Thursday, the Washington Nationals (30-60) play the Atlanta Braves (52-37), fellow members of the NL East, at 7:05 PM ET. The scheduled starters are Kyle Wright (10-4) for the Braves, and Anibal Sanchez for the Nationals.

The Braves have been made a heavy favorite by sportsbooks, despite playing on the road. They’re sitting at -226 to defeat the Nationals (+190). The contest has an over/under set at 9.5.

Last Time Out: Braves and Nationals

The Braves lost 7-3 to the Mets yesterday, with Charlie Morton (five innings, giving up five earned runs on six hits while striking out six) on the line for the loss. Eddie Rosario went 3-for-4 with a double, a home run and an RBI to lead the Braves offensively in the defeat.

The Nationals lost to the Mariners yesterday, with Erick Fedde getting the loss while pitching five innings, giving up two earned runs on six hits while striking out one. Juan Soto went 1-for-4 with a home run and an RBI to lead the Nationals’ offense.

Braves Betting Records and Team Stats

The Braves have been favorites in 68 games this season and won 45 (66.2%) of those contests. Atlanta has a record of 10-3 in games where sportsbooks favor them by at least -226 on the moneyline. The implied probability of a win from the Braves, based on the moneyline, is 69.3%. Atlanta and its opponents have gone over the total this season in 43 of their 90 opportunities. The Braves are 44-46-0 against the spread in their 90 chances this season.

Nationals Betting Records and Team Stats

The Nationals have won in 23, or 30.7%, of the 75 contests they have been named as odds-on underdogs in this year. This season, Washington has come away with a win three times in eight chances when named as an underdog of at least +190 or worse on the moneyline. The Nationals have an implied victory probability of 34.5% according to the moneyline set for this matchup. Washington and its opponents have gone over the total this season in 43 of their 90 opportunities. The Nationals are 38-52-0 against the spread in their 90 games that had a posted line this season.
